 * Forms that are successfully submitted by the Contact Form 7 plugin are not being
   stored by the Contact Form to DB.
 * When viewing the CFDB page in the admin it just says “No form submissions in 
   the database”
 * The forms are mailed successfully. I can’t find them anything in the WordPress
   database but than again I’m not sure were to look.
 * The install is hosted on WPengine. At this moment I can’t test it localy as do
   to unrelated issues.
 * I did notice the issue few weeks ago and few updated to both plugins have occurred
   since than but non fixed nor broke the plugin as far as I know.
 * Everything is up to date, plugins and systems.

 * If WPEngine uses WordPress multisite, then CFDB will not work. It doesn’t work
   with multisite.

 * Stuff I should ask for due diligence:
    – Ensure the plugin is enabled – Check
   that in the CFDB Options page the setting for capturing Contact Form 7 forms 
   is set to true. It should be true be default.
 * Assuming the above is true, then I’m not sure what the issue is.
 * If the plugin cannot create its wp_cf7dbplugin_submits table during its initial
   installation, then it will fail. Check if that table is there. (“wp_” in the 
   table name might be different for you).
 * In the CFDB Options page, there is an option to designate a file to write error
   output to. If you can indicate a file on your server and be able to access it,
   then you can see if the plugin is reporting an error.
